Pine Tree Trimming in San Jose, CA
Pine tree trimming services involve the careful pruning and shaping of pine trees to maintain their health, appearance, and safety. These projects can include removing dead or diseased branches, reducing the size of overgrown trees, and shaping the canopy to improve airflow and sunlight penetration. Homeowners often seek this service to prevent potential hazards such as falling branches, to enhance curb appeal, or to promote the overall vitality of their pine trees. Before requesting trimming, property owners should consider the size and location of the trees, as well as any specific goals for shaping or health maintenance.
Understanding the scope of pine tree trimming is essential for property owners planning to request this service. It’s helpful to know that trimming is typically performed during specific seasons to avoid stress on the trees, and that improper pruning can sometimes cause damage. Clarifying the desired outcome-whether it’s safety, aesthetics, or health-can ensure the work aligns with expectations. Property owners should also consider the potential impact on nearby structures, power lines, or other landscape features when planning pine tree trimming projects.

Common Pine Tree Trimming Jobs
Tree pruning - shaping trees to promote healthy growth and maintain appearance.
Deadwood removal - eliminating dead or diseased branches to prevent damage.
Thinning services - reducing dense foliage to improve airflow and sunlight penetration.
Crown cleaning - removing crossing or weak branches to enhance tree stability.
Structural trimming - shaping young trees for proper development and aesthetics.
Storm damage trimming - clearing broken or hazardous branches after severe weather.
Pine Tree Trimming Questions
Why is regular pine tree trimming important? Regular trimming helps maintain the health and appearance of pine trees, preventing overgrowth and reducing the risk of falling branches.
What are common reasons to request pine tree trimming? Property owners often seek trimming to remove dead or diseased branches, improve safety, or enhance the landscape’s aesthetic appeal.
How does trimming affect pine tree growth? Proper trimming encourages healthy growth, improves airflow, and can help shape the tree for better stability and visual balance.
When is the best time to trim pine trees? The optimal time for trimming is during the late winter or early spring when the tree is dormant, reducing stress and promoting healthy growth.
